Lovers of food and art will delight in Megan Fizell's blog, Feasting on Art. Drawing ideas and ingredients from renowned artists – including Claude Monet, Utagawa Kuniyoshi and Raphaelle Peale – Megan has devised her own still-life inspired recipes.


We've handpicked 12 of Megan's recipes and the artworks which led her to create them. Click on an image for the recipe and to learn more about the motivation behind each one.

Pickling

Pickling is a common preservation technique. Start by gently boiling a brine of water, vinegar and salt. Pour this into a sterilised jar with preferred vegetables, such as cucumbers. For an extra kick, add garlic, horseradish and whole dill stems. Seal the jar and leave for several weeks to ferment.
